diff options
Diffstat (limited to 'net-misc/netkit-rsh')
-rw-r--r-- | net-misc/netkit-rsh/ChangeLog | 9 | ||||
-rw-r--r-- | net-misc/netkit-rsh/files/digest-netkit-rsh-0.17-r6 | 4 | ||||
-rw-r--r-- | net-misc/netkit-rsh/files/digest-netkit-rsh-0.17-r7 | 4 | ||||
-rw-r--r-- | net-misc/netkit-rsh/netkit-rsh-0.17-r6.ebuild | 13 | ||||
-rw-r--r-- | net-misc/netkit-rsh/netkit-rsh-0.17-r7.ebuild | 13 |
5 files changed, 33 insertions, 10 deletions
diff --git a/net-misc/netkit-rsh/ChangeLog b/net-misc/netkit-rsh/ChangeLog index 5343b1dd210a..a1221a3cf9be 100644 --- a/net-misc/netkit-rsh/ChangeLog +++ b/net-misc/netkit-rsh/ChangeLog @@ -1,6 +1,11 @@ # ChangeLog for net-misc/netkit-rsh -# Copyright 1999-2005 Gentoo Foundation; Distributed under the GPL v2 -# $Header: /var/cvsroot/gentoo-x86/net-misc/netkit-rsh/ChangeLog,v 1.27 2005/12/25 15:18:13 flameeyes Exp $ +# Copyright 1999-2006 Gentoo Foundation; Distributed under the GPL v2 +# $Header: /var/cvsroot/gentoo-x86/net-misc/netkit-rsh/ChangeLog,v 1.28 2006/06/28 17:28:03 kanaka Exp $ + + 28 Jun 2006; Joel Martin <kanaka@gentoo.org> netkit-rsh-0.17-r6.ebuild, + netkit-rsh-0.17-r7.ebuild: + Allow cross-compiling by sed-removing runtime tests from lame non-autoconf + configure script. 25 Dec 2005; Diego Pettenò <flameeyes@gentoo.org> +files/netkit-rsh-0.16-rlogin-rsh.patch, diff --git a/net-misc/netkit-rsh/files/digest-netkit-rsh-0.17-r6 b/net-misc/netkit-rsh/files/digest-netkit-rsh-0.17-r6 index a734efb0e00a..c12dc45c703a 100644 --- a/net-misc/netkit-rsh/files/digest-netkit-rsh-0.17-r6 +++ b/net-misc/netkit-rsh/files/digest-netkit-rsh-0.17-r6 @@ -1,2 +1,6 @@ MD5 65f5f28e2fe22d9ad8b17bb9a10df096 netkit-rsh-0.17.tar.gz 58268 +RMD160 288dd91c84fcebde8e401d3d0bf93d99c3bac73e netkit-rsh-0.17.tar.gz 58268 +SHA256 edcac7fa18015f0bc04e573f3f54ae3b638d71335df1ad7dae692779914ad669 netkit-rsh-0.17.tar.gz 58268 MD5 17c2b2fa2aed6af7e0b850673d5ef1f9 rexec-1.5.tar.gz 18469 +RMD160 713ed4e6ec125f8f0b8056eb53b41e4e34e6c29b rexec-1.5.tar.gz 18469 +SHA256 9bcf9986eb9637d1b8e8ab62a61c80f3422d628e837e72c6ad8c2e38604ccaf4 rexec-1.5.tar.gz 18469 diff --git a/net-misc/netkit-rsh/files/digest-netkit-rsh-0.17-r7 b/net-misc/netkit-rsh/files/digest-netkit-rsh-0.17-r7 index a734efb0e00a..c12dc45c703a 100644 --- a/net-misc/netkit-rsh/files/digest-netkit-rsh-0.17-r7 +++ b/net-misc/netkit-rsh/files/digest-netkit-rsh-0.17-r7 @@ -1,2 +1,6 @@ MD5 65f5f28e2fe22d9ad8b17bb9a10df096 netkit-rsh-0.17.tar.gz 58268 +RMD160 288dd91c84fcebde8e401d3d0bf93d99c3bac73e netkit-rsh-0.17.tar.gz 58268 +SHA256 edcac7fa18015f0bc04e573f3f54ae3b638d71335df1ad7dae692779914ad669 netkit-rsh-0.17.tar.gz 58268 MD5 17c2b2fa2aed6af7e0b850673d5ef1f9 rexec-1.5.tar.gz 18469 +RMD160 713ed4e6ec125f8f0b8056eb53b41e4e34e6c29b rexec-1.5.tar.gz 18469 +SHA256 9bcf9986eb9637d1b8e8ab62a61c80f3422d628e837e72c6ad8c2e38604ccaf4 rexec-1.5.tar.gz 18469 diff --git a/net-misc/netkit-rsh/netkit-rsh-0.17-r6.ebuild b/net-misc/netkit-rsh/netkit-rsh-0.17-r6.ebuild index b4aa008f1920..3d37eedfc158 100644 --- a/net-misc/netkit-rsh/netkit-rsh-0.17-r6.ebuild +++ b/net-misc/netkit-rsh/netkit-rsh-0.17-r6.ebuild @@ -1,8 +1,8 @@ -# Copyright 1999-2005 Gentoo Foundation +# Copyright 1999-2006 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/net-misc/netkit-rsh/netkit-rsh-0.17-r6.ebuild,v 1.10 2005/08/22 22:15:34 vapier Exp $ +# $Header: /var/cvsroot/gentoo-x86/net-misc/netkit-rsh/netkit-rsh-0.17-r6.ebuild,v 1.11 2006/06/28 17:28:03 kanaka Exp $ -inherit eutils pam +inherit eutils pam toolchain-funcs DESCRIPTION="Netkit's Remote Shell Suite: rexec{,d} rlogin{,d} rsh{,d}" HOMEPAGE="ftp://ftp.uk.linux.org/pub/linux/Networking/netkit/" @@ -33,12 +33,17 @@ src_unpack() { src_compile() { local myconf use pam || myconf="--without-pam" + if tc-is-cross-compiler; then + tc-export CC + # Can't do runtime tests when cross-compiling + sed -i -e "s|./__conftest|: ./__conftest|" configure + fi ./configure ${myconf} || die sed -i \ -e "s:-pipe -O2:${CFLAGS}:" \ -e "s:-Wpointer-arith::" \ - MCONFIG + MCONFIG || die "could not sed MCONFIG" make || die } diff --git a/net-misc/netkit-rsh/netkit-rsh-0.17-r7.ebuild b/net-misc/netkit-rsh/netkit-rsh-0.17-r7.ebuild index 8207734ede96..8bf9ff9846c3 100644 --- a/net-misc/netkit-rsh/netkit-rsh-0.17-r7.ebuild +++ b/net-misc/netkit-rsh/netkit-rsh-0.17-r7.ebuild @@ -1,8 +1,8 @@ -# Copyright 1999-2005 Gentoo Foundation +# Copyright 1999-2006 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/net-misc/netkit-rsh/netkit-rsh-0.17-r7.ebuild,v 1.3 2005/12/25 15:18:13 flameeyes Exp $ +# $Header: /var/cvsroot/gentoo-x86/net-misc/netkit-rsh/netkit-rsh-0.17-r7.ebuild,v 1.4 2006/06/28 17:28:03 kanaka Exp $ -inherit eutils pam flag-o-matic +inherit eutils pam flag-o-matic toolchain-funcs DESCRIPTION="Netkit's Remote Shell Suite: rexec{,d} rlogin{,d} rsh{,d}" HOMEPAGE="ftp://ftp.uk.linux.org/pub/linux/Networking/netkit/" @@ -33,12 +33,17 @@ src_unpack() { src_compile() { local myconf use pam || myconf="--without-pam" + if tc-is-cross-compiler; then + tc-export CC + # Can't do runtime tests when cross-compiling + sed -i -e "s|./__conftest|: ./__conftest|" configure + fi ./configure ${myconf} || die sed -i \ -e "s:-pipe -O2:${CFLAGS}:" \ -e "s:-Wpointer-arith::" \ - MCONFIG + MCONFIG || die "could not sed MCONFIG" make || die } |